是否使用2核1G的云服务器来搭建个人博客或企业官网,取决于网站的具体类型、内容规模、访问量和功能需求。下面我们分别分析两种情况:
一、个人博客:✅ 基本足够(但有前提)
✅ 适用场景:
- 使用轻量级CMS如:WordPress(优化后)、Typecho、Halo、Hexo(静态部署)、Ghost 等。
- 内容以文字、图片为主,文章数量在几百篇以内。
- 日均访问量较低(<1000 PV/天)。
- 不频繁更新,无大量插件或高消耗主题。
⚠️ 注意事项:
- 数据库优化:MySQL/MariaDB 占用内存较多,建议配置小内存模式。
- Web服务器选择:推荐使用 Nginx + PHP-FPM(精简配置),或 Caddy 等轻量服务。
- 开启缓存:使用 Redis 或 WP Super Cache 等减少动态请求。
- 避免资源密集型插件:如实时统计、自动备份、SEO 工具过多等。
- 考虑静态化:用 Hexo、Hugo、VuePress 等生成静态页面,托管到对象存储(如 COS、OSS)+ CDN,更省资源。
? 建议:如果使用 WordPress,务必优化配置,否则 1G 内存在高峰时可能 OOM(内存溢出)。
二、企业官网:✅ 勉强可用,但需谨慎
✅ 适合的企业官网类型:
- 展示型官网(公司介绍、产品展示、联系方式等)。
- 页面数量少(<20页),内容静态为主。
- 无复杂交互功能(如在线支付、用户登录、后台管理系统复杂)。
- 访问量低(本地中小企业,日访问几百次)。
❌ 不适合的情况:
- 含大量图片/视频自动加载。
- 使用重型建站系统(如 Drupal、未优化的 WordPress 主题)。
- 需要集成 CRM、表单收集、会员系统等动态功能。
- 高并发访问(如推广活动期间流量激增)。
三、性能优化建议(提升2核1G表现)
| 优化项 | 推荐做法 |
|---|---|
| Web 服务器 | 使用 Nginx 而非 Apache(更省内存) |
| PHP 配置 | 调整 PHP-FPM 子进程数(如只开2-4个) |
| 数据库 | 使用 MariaDB 替代 MySQL,调小缓冲池(innodb_buffer_pool_size = 128M) |
| 缓存机制 | 开启 OPcache、Redis / Memcached 缓存查询 |
| 静态资源 | 使用 CDN 托管 JS/CSS/图片 |
| 系统监控 | 安装 htop、netdata 监控资源使用 |
四、替代方案(更优选择)
| 方案 | 优点 | 适用场景 |
|---|---|---|
| 静态网站 + 对象存储 + CDN | 成本低、速度快、无需维护服务器 | 个人博客、企业展示站 |
| Serverless CMS(如 Notion + Vercel) | 免运维、自动扩展 | 内容驱动型博客 |
| 升级为2核2G或2核4G | 更稳定,支持更多功能 | 中小型企业站、高访问博客 |
✅ 总结
| 场景 | 是否足够 | 建议 |
|---|---|---|
| 轻量个人博客 | ✅ 够用 | 做好优化,推荐静态生成 |
| 普通企业官网 | ⚠️ 勉强可用 | 避免复杂功能,建议升级配置 |
| 高访问/功能复杂网站 | ❌ 不足 | 至少2核2G起步 |
? 结论:2核1G 可作为入门选择,适合低流量、轻量级网站。长期运营建议预留升级空间,或优先考虑静态化部署以降低成本与维护难度。
如有具体技术栈(如 WordPress、Django、React 等),可进一步评估资源需求。
CDNK博客